A debris flow consisting primarily of volcanic ash and lava boulders. Heavy rain, and melting snow and ice during a volcanic eruption mix with the loose deposits and form fast-moving tongues of slurry, commonly in existing channels. Lahars are one of the most serious hazards associated with ice-covered volcanoes (Figure L.1). Lahar features on the volcano, Ruapehu on North Island, New Zealand. (a) The channels, along which a devastating lahar flowed on 24 December 1953, following an eruption and partial melting of a glacier in the summit crater. (b) The railway bridge at Tangiwai, which was demolished by the lahar, resulting in destruction of a train and a loss of 151 lives. Both images show the aftermath of a more recent, smaller lahar in March 2007. An early warning system installed after the 1953 disaster led to temporary closure of the railway and adjacent road, thus preventing a further accident. https://s3-euw1-ap-pe-df-pch-content-public-p.s3.eu-west-1.amazonaws.com/9781315373157/95d5ad9e-a71d-4f11-a609-2c025b95638b/content/figl_1.jpg"/>
